About The Position

The Role: General Motors is seeking a highly skilled Onsite & Test Cell Support Technician to provide hands‑on technical assistance across both traditional end‑user environments and mission‑critical Test Cell operations. This role is focused on troubleshooting, diagnosing, and resolving complex hardware and system issues, partnering closely with engineers, calibration teams, operators, IT groups, and third‑party vendors to ensure maximum uptime and reliable test operations. What You’ll Do: Diagnose, repair, and replace PCs, rugged/semi‑rugged laptops, peripherals, printers, plotters, and engineering accessories. Resolve device and component‑level failures (e.g. NVMe drives, RAM, motherboards, screens, keyboards). Execute device imaging, configuration, and data transfer using approved tools. Investigate recurring or complex issues and perform root‑cause analysis. Troubleshoot issues affecting test cell workstations, calibration laptops and diagnostic hardware. Support engineering software and calibration applications. Collaborate with Test Cell Operations to ensure reliability and limited downtime. Support Test Cell builds, Windows Long Term Servicing Channel environments, patching and security compliance. Partner with internal IT teams and external vendors for escalations. Manage ServiceNow tickets with accurate logging and asset tracking. Support onboarding/offboarding hardware prep, refresh cycles, and equipment lifecycle. Maintain a secure, organized workspace aligned with GM safety and data policies. Work Environment Onsite at GM facilities and Test Cell labs with occasional travel to local sites as needed. Standard business hours with occasional after-hours for critical testing. Frequent interaction with engineers, operators, IT, and vendors. Performance Metrics Ticket response and resolution times. Quality of troubleshooting and problem-solving. Customer satisfaction. Accuracy of documentation and asset management. Adherence to safety, security, and operational standards.

Requirements

  • Strong troubleshooting skills across PCs, laptops, peripherals, and engineering hardware.
  • A minimum of two (2) years of relevant experience is required; experience in lab, test cell, or engineering workstation environments is desirable but not mandatory.
  • Ability to follow standardized procedures for imaging, repair, and asset handling.
  • Strong communication and customer service skills.
  • Ability to work independently and manage multiple tasks.
  • Physical ability to lift and move equipment.

Nice To Haves

  • Proficient in one or more of these operating systems: Windows 7, 10, 11, MAC, Linux Ubuntu
  • Strong understanding of client server hardware and software applications
  • Experience with calibration/test cell workflows and diagnostic tools.
  • Strong understanding of private networks
  • Good understanding of LAN/WAN infrastructure and segmentation
